Why Tracking User Engagement Matters
Monitoring engagement during live streams provides valuable insights into viewer interests and participation levels. It helps identify which parts of the event are most captivating and where viewers might lose interest. This data can inform content adjustments and marketing strategies, leading to higher viewer retention and satisfaction.
Key Metrics to Monitor
- View Count: The total number of viewers at any given time.
- Engagement Rate: The percentage of viewers interacting through chats, polls, or reactions.
- Average Watch Time: How long viewers stay tuned during the stream.
- Peak Concurrent Viewers: The highest number of viewers watching simultaneously.
- Drop-off Points: Moments when viewer numbers decline sharply.
Tools for Tracking Engagement
Several tools can help you monitor user engagement effectively:
- Streaming Platforms: YouTube Live, Facebook Live, and Twitch offer built-in analytics.
- Third-Party Analytics: Tools like Streamlabs, Restream, and StreamElements provide detailed engagement metrics.
- Chat and Poll Integrations: Use interactive features to gauge viewer participation in real-time.
Strategies to Enhance Engagement
To boost engagement during your live stream, consider implementing these strategies:
- Encourage Interaction: Ask questions and invite viewers to comment.
- Use Polls and Quizzes: Incorporate real-time polls to involve viewers.
- Respond to Comments: Address viewer questions and feedback promptly.
- Offer Incentives: Provide giveaways or exclusive content for active participants.
- Analyze Data Post-Event: Review engagement metrics to improve future streams.
